Regards to going turbo and what you will usually need to factor in:

- bigger injectors
- remap fuel system (unichip, safc, etc.)
- intercooler
- turbo
- cooler pipes
- tapped oil sump
- decomp plate
- oil and water lines teed off the pressure sender
- turbo exhaust manifold and modified exhaust pipe
- fuel pump and pressure regulator depending on boost levels.
- modplate or engineering.

forged internals if you wanting to run decent psi and not *meow* footing.


Intercooler setup


On a standard front bar ce lancer (h) 300mm intercooler is to big to fit really. 180mm will fill the middle gap of the stock bar and 220mm will fit with out the intercooler petruding under the stock bar or interferring with the tow hook.

Evo Stock Turbo Specs
Evolution 1
p/n = 49168-01450
Turbo = TDO5H-16G-7
Nozzle Area (cm2) = 7
TD05H turbine = Inconel (steel alloy)
Compressor = Aluminium
Inducer = 48.3mm
Exducer = 68mm

Evolution 2
p/n = 49168-01460
Turbo = TDO5H-16G-7
Nozzle Area (cm2) = 7
TD05H turbine = Inconel (steel alloy)
Compressor = Aluminium
Inducer = 48.3mm
Exducer = 68mm

Evolution 3
p/n = 49178-01470
Turbo = TD05H-16G6-7
Nozzle Area (cm2) = 7
TD05H turbine = Inconel (steel alloy)
Compressor = Aluminium
Inducer = 48.3mm
Exducer = 68mm
